The Verdict

Samsung Galaxy S23+ and Apple iPhone SE (2020) occupy entirely different market segments. Samsung's flagship delivers a 6.6-inch Dynamic AMOLED display with 120Hz refresh rate and 1750 nits brightness, paired with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 processing, 8GB RAM, and a versatile quad-camera system featuring 50MP main and 3x optical zoom. Apple's budget option offers a compact 4.7-inch Retina LCD display, A13 Bionic chip, 3GB RAM, and dual cameras. Battery capacity differs dramatically: 4700 mAh versus 1821 mAh. Galaxy S23+ includes 5G, 45W charging, and USB-C, while iPhone SE lacks 5G and relies on Lightning with 7.5W wireless charging. At $999 versus $399, the S23+ justifies premium pricing with flagship performance, modern connectivity, and superior display technology. iPhone SE remains excellent for users prioritizing compactness and iOS ecosystem at budget-friendly pricing. Recommendation: Choose Galaxy S23+ for comprehensive flagship features and future-proofing; select iPhone SE for budget-conscious users valuing portability and simplicity.

Pros & Cons

Apple iPhone SE (2020)

Pros

  • Incredibly affordable at $399 with flagship A13 chip
  • Compact and lightweight design
  • Touch ID home button
  • Wi-Fi 6 support
  • Long software support from Apple

Cons

  • Tiny 1821 mAh battery with poor endurance
  • Dated design with thick bezels
  • Single rear camera with no ultrawide
  • 750p LCD display
  • No 5G support

Samsung Galaxy S23+

Pros

  •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 for Galaxy delivers top-tier performance
  • Bright 1750-nit display is excellent in direct sunlight
  • 4700 mAh battery provides strong all-day endurance
  • Four years of OS updates and five years of security patches
  • Versatile triple camera with 3x optical zoom

Cons

  • Only 8 GB RAM at the $999 price point
  • FHD+ resolution instead of QHD+ on the 6.6-inch display
  • 45W charging is slower than Chinese competitors
  • No expandable storage or microSD slot
  • Design is very similar to S22+ with minimal visual changes
